Year-Round Maintenance Tips for Your Outdoor Space

Routine care is vital for maintaining an attractive outdoor space throughout the year. Property owners ought to create a periodic care routine that addresses the unique needs of their landscapes. In spring, clearing debris and pruning plants encourages strong development. The warmer months require regular watering and weeding to keep gardens vibrant.

When fall begins you should get ready for the winter months by aerating your lawn and applying mulch to protect plant roots. Furthermore, fall is the perfect time to sow bulbs for a vibrant spring bloom.

During winter, routine snow clearing from paths and driveways maintains safety while shielding delicate plants from substantial snow buildup.

Investing in an efficient irrigation system and planting indigenous plants can reduce maintenance needs and support eco-friendly practices. By adopting these seasonal upkeep strategies, homeowners can make certain their exterior areas remain inviting and beautiful, no matter the time of year.

How Do I Pick the Right Plants for My Local Climate?

To identify the most suitable plants for a local climate, one should examine local weather patterns, soil conditions, and native species. Seeking guidance from local horticulturists or gardening centers can offer tailored advice for effective plant selection.

What Permits Do You Need for Landscaping Projects?

Before starting landscaping projects, property owners often need permits for zoning, tree removal, or construction. Municipal regulations differ, so consulting with municipal offices guarantees compliance and helps avoid unnecessary fines or delays to your project.

How Do I Enhance Soil Quality for Plants?

Enhancing soil health for plant growth includes mixing in natural organic content like composted material, adopting crop rotation, guaranteeing proper drainage, monitoring pH levels, and incorporating mulch to retain moisture, cultivating a healthier environment for optimal plant growth.

When Is the Ideal Time to Plant Seasonal Flowers?

The optimal times to cultivate seasonal flowers generally include spring after the last frost and fall for cool-weather varieties. Proper timing ensures optimal growth, permitting flowers to prosper across their individual blooming seasons for the greatest visual effect.

How Do I Prevent Pests in My Garden?

To prevent pests in a garden, one can employ natural repellents like neem oil, introduce beneficial insects, keep the soil healthy, and practice regular crop rotation. Moreover, thorough sanitation and protective barriers can greatly reduce pest populations.
